KVM: arm64: selftests: get-reg-list: Prepare to run multiple configs at once

We don't want to have to create a new binary for each vcpu config, so
prepare to run the test for multiple vcpu configs in a single binary.
We do this by factoring out the test from main() and then looping over
configs. When given '--list' we still never print more than a single
reg-list for a single vcpu config though, because it would be confusing
otherwise.

No functional change intended.
